Automatisierte Anwendungsinstallation zur Erzeugung von Ablaufumgebungen

Amzar, Cornelius Automatisierte Anwendungsinstallation zur Erzeugung von Ablaufumgebungen., 2012 Master's Thesis thesis, Universität Freiburg. [Thesis]

[thumbnail of Masterarbeit_final.pdf]

Download (1MB) | Preview

English abstract

Digital preservation is currently a very important field of research because the amount of available digital information is rapidly increasing. However, this information is forgotten just as rapidly as the underlying technology changes and becomes obsolete, at an ever increasing speed. There are two different approaches to solve this problem: Migration and Emulation. Both have their pros and cons. The complexity of todays operating environments is huge and one requires a variety of applications and software components in order to display a given digital object correctly. This makes both emulation and migration a sophisticated and expensive process. In this work, methods are introduced which allow for the automatic creation of a run-time environment for given digital objects. This means that the installation of various programs is automated. Further, various guidelines to maintain plattform independence are examined and applied.

German abstract

Die digitale Langzeitarchivierung ist ein aktuell sehr wichtiges Forschungsthema, denn die Menge der digital verfügbaren Informationen wächst rasant. Diese Informationen geraten jedoch genau so schnell wieder in Vergessenheit, da die zugrundeliegende Technik innerhalb kürzester Zeit veraltet. Es gibt zwei verschiedene Ansätze zur Lösung dieses Problems, Migration und Emulation. Beide haben ihre spezifischen Vor- und Nachteile. Die Komplexität heutiger Arbeitsumgebungen ist immens, es ist eine Vielzahl von Anwendungen und anderen Softwarebausteinen notwendig, um ein gegebenes digitales Objekt fehlerfrei anzuzeigen. Dies macht sowohl die Emulation als auch die Migration aufwändig und teuer. In dieser Arbeit werden Methoden vorgestellt, die es ermöglichen eine Ablaufumgebung für bestimmte digitale Objekte automatisch zu erzeugen. Das bedeutet, dass die Installation unterschiedlicher Software automatisiert erfolgt. Im Weiteren werden diverse Richtlinien zur Bewahrung der Plattformunabhängigkeit untersucht und angewendet.

Item type: Thesis (UNSPECIFIED)
Keywords: digital preservation, metadata, digital curation, VNCplay, software archive,
Subjects: A. Theoretical and general aspects of libraries and information. > AA. Library and information science as a field.
D. Libraries as physical collections. > DJ. Technical libraries.
Depositing user: Cornelius Amzar
Date deposited: 13 Sep 2012
Last modified: 02 Oct 2014 12:23


Anderson u. a. 2010

Anderson, David ; Delve, Janet ; Pinchbeck, Dan: Towards a workable,

emulation-based preservation strategy: rationale and technical metadata. In:

New review of information networking (2010), Nr. 15, S. 110–131. – URL http:

// – ISSN 1361-4576

Anderson u. a. 2009

Anderson, David ; Delve, Janet ; Pinchbeck, Dan ; Alemu, Getaneh A.:

Preliminary document analyzing and summarizing metadata standards and issues

across Europe / KEEP - Keeping Emulation Environments Portable. 2009. –


Caplan 2009

Caplan, Priscilla: Understanding PREMIS. Februar 2009. – URL http:


Farquhar und Hockx-Yu 2007

Farquhar, Adam ; Hockx-Yu, Helen: Planets: Integrated Services for Digital

Preservation. In: International Journal of Digital Curation 2 (2007), Nr. 2. –

URL – ISSN 1746-8256

Genev 2010

Genev, Evgeni: VNC Interface for Java X86-Emulator Dioscuri. Online, Oktober 2010. – URL http://hdl.

van der Hoeven 2007a

Hoeven, Jeffrey van der: Dioscuri: emulator for digital preservation. In: DLib

Magazine 13 (2007), Nr. 11/12. – URL

november07/11inbrief.html#VANDERHOEVEN. – ISSN 1082-9873

van der Hoeven 2007b

Hoeven, Jeffrey van der: Emulation for Digital Preservation in Practice: The

Results. In: International Journal of Digital Curation 2 (2007), S. 123–132

Kulzhabayev 2012

Kulzhabayev, Alibek: Abstract Unattended Workflow Interactions. Masterthesis.

Januar 2012. – URL

McDonough 2006

McDonough, Jerome P.: METS: Standardized Encoding for Digital Library

Objects. In: International Journal on Digital Libraries 6 (2006), S. 148–158. –


OPF 2011

OPF: Open Planets Foundation. Online, 2011. –


Philipps 2010

Philipps, Mario: Entwurf und Implementierung eines Softwarearchivs für die

digitale Langzeitarchivierung, Diplomarbeit, Juli 2010. – URL http://hdl.

QEMU Developers 2011

QEMU Developers: QEMU – Open Source Processor Emulator. Online, 2011. – URL

Rechert u. a. 2009

Rechert, Klaus ; Suchodoletz, Dirk von ; Welte, Randolph ; Dobbelsteen,

Maurice van den ; Roberts, Bill ; Hoeven, Jeffrey van der ; Schroder,

Jasper: Novel Workflows for Abstract Handling of Complex Interaction Processes

in Digital Preservation. In: Proceedings of the Sixth International Conference on

Preservation of Digital Objects (iPRES09), 2009

Rechert u. a. 2010

Rechert, Klaus ; Suchodoletz, Dirk von ; Welte, Randolph ; Ruzzoli, Felix

; Valizada isgandar: Reliable Preservation of Interactive Environments and

Workflows. In: Lalmas, Mounia (Hrsg.) ; Jose, Joemon M. (Hrsg.) ; Rauber,

Andreas (Hrsg.) ; Sebastiani, Fabrizio (Hrsg.) ; Frommholz, Ingo (Hrsg.):

Research and Advanced Technology for Digital Libraries, 14th European Conference,

ECDL 2010, Glasgow, UK, September 6-10, 2010. Proceedings Bd. 6273,

Springer, 2010, S. 494–497

Reichherzer und Brown 2006

Reichherzer, Thomas ; Brown, Geoffrey: Quantifying software requirements

for supporting archived office documents using emulation. In: Digital Libraries,

2006. JCDL ’06. Proceedings of the 6th ACM/IEEE-CS Joint Conference on,

june 2006, S. 86–94

Rothenberg 1999

Rothenberg, Jeff: Ensuring the Longevity of Digital Information. Online, 1999. – URL http://www.

Ruzzoli 2009

Ruzzoli, Felix: Ein Framework für die zustandsbasierte Fehlererkennung und

Behandlung von interaktiven Arbeitsabläufen. Bachelorthesis. 2009

Strodl u. a. 2007

Strodl, Stephan ; Becker, Christoph ; Neumayer, Robert ; Rauber, Andreas:

How to Choose a Digital Preservation Strategy Evaluating a Preservation

Planning Procedure. In: Proceedings of the 7th ACM/IEEE-CS joint conference

on Digital libraries, 2007

von Suchodoletz 2009

Suchodoletz, Dirk von: Funktionale Langzeitarchivierung digitaler Objekte –

Erfolgsbedingungen für den Einsatz von Emulationsstrategien, Dissertation, 2009

von Suchodoletz u. a. 2010

Suchodoletz, Dirk von ; Rechert, Klaus ; Welte, Randolph ; Dobbelsteen,

Maurice van den ; Roberts, Bill ; Hoeven, Jeffrey van der ; Schroder,

Jasper: Automation of Flexible Migration Workflows. In: International Journal

of Digital Curation 2 (2010), Nr. 2. – URL

php/ijdc/article/view/172/240. – ISSN 1746-8256

Tchayep 2011

Tchayep, Achille N.: Emulatoren-Testing für die digitale Langzeitarchivierung.

Masterthesis. März 2011. – URL

TNA 2010

TNA, The National Archives: The technical registry PRONOM. Online, 2010. – URL http://www. – Online resource

Valizada 2011

Valizada, Isgandar: Large-Scale, Transparent Format Migration System. Masterthesis.

2011. – URL


Welte 2009

Welte, Randolph: Funktionale Langzeitarchivierung digitaler Objekte – Entwicklung

eines Demonstrators zur Internet-Nutzung emulierter Ablaufumgebungen.

Südwestdeutscher Verlag für Hochschulschriften, 2009

Zeldovich und Chandra 2005

Zeldovich, Nickolai ; Chandra, Ramesh: Interactive performance measurement

with VNCplay. In: ATEC ’05: Proceedings of the annual conference on

USENIX Annual Techni


Downloads per month over past year

Actions (login required)

View Item View Item